Reexamination

see synonyms of reexamination

Noun

1. redirect examination, reexamination

(law) questioning of a witness by the party that called the witness after that witness has been subject to cross-examination

2. follow-up, followup, reexamination, review

a subsequent examination of a patient for the purpose of monitoring earlier treatment

Reexamination

see synonyms of reexamination
noun
1. 
a second or repeated examination
2.  Law
the questioning of one's own witness after, and about matters taken up in, the cross-examination
